Got a bit of money coming my way and am interested to find out what I can do to my 16v for bigger power.

Has anyone supercharged or put their 16v on throttle bodies. Details and info on where to get parts and exactly what has to be done for the conversion would be appreciated!

Considering my engine has less than 50k on it and it still VERY strong, I think this would be a great project.

I know having more power on FWD is a problem due to traction so was wondering if I could do a p4 conversion? Would be grateful if anyone could provide me with any info on these subjects. Excuse the lack of technical talk, I am a bit new to all this.

AhMotorsports do lots of tuning stuff for 33s - they do a throttle body kit for about £1300 I think (www.ahmotorsports.co.uk).

If you're thinking of a supercharger, I have seen this done before and I'm sure someone on this forum will be able to help. If you're after one now, there's someone on the alfa145 forum who has one for sale at £150 (www.alfa145.com for sale section) - I believe its off a mini cooper.

With regards to the P4 conversion, I don't think this will be possible as I think the P4 bodyshell is slightly different and the propshaft won't fit on a 2wd car. I'm sure a good suspension set up and an LSD will be able to transmit all the power (an Alfa 147 GTA has 250bhp going through the frony wheels and they seem to work ok.
